A study in Ophthalmology found tirzepatide use was associated with lower 12-month risk of new or progressive diabetic retinopathy versus lifestyle intervention alone. The analysis included about 174,000 matched patients.
The FDA approved updated labeling for Vabysmo to allow extended treatment of macular edema following retinal vein occlusion beyond six months. The label update removes the prior 6-month restriction and retains monthly 6 mg intravitreal dosing.

Ocular Therapeutix announced positive topline results from the SOL-1 Phase 3 superiority trial of AXPAXLI for wet age-related macular degeneration, meeting its primary endpoint with statistically significant improvements in vision outcomes compared to aflibercept.
The European Commission has approved Gotenfia (golimumab), a biosimilar to Simponi developed by Bio-Thera and marketed by STADA, for chronic inflammatory autoimmune diseases across the EU and EEA.

AAV-based gene therapy offers sustained intraocular delivery of anti-angiogenic agents with a single treatment for neovascular AMD, with leading clinical candidates including RGX-314, ADVM-022, 4D-150, and NG101.
